    Emily was born in Wilton, Connecticut. In high school, she worked at Ralph Lauren and had a short modeling career.
  • She graduates

    She graduates
    Emily graduated from New York University with a degree in studio art.
  • Emily starts her blog

    Emily starts her blog
    Emily had a beauty blog called "Into the Gloss" and has interviewed many famous celebrities including model Karlie Kloss.
  • She begins raising money

    She begins raising money
    Emily quit her job at Vogue and started approaching venture capitalists for ideas about expansion. She raised $2 million with the help of Kirsten Green, the founder of Forerunner Ventures.
  • Glossier was created

    Glossier was created
    Emily created Glossier in 2014 after raising money from venture capitalists. Glossier started out with 4 products.
